Abstract

Traditional agricultural landscape is an important part of rural community’s life and perceived as a cultural heritage. There are various cultural values and agricultural systems with local wisdom that should be preserved. One of the strategies that can be carried out is the initiative of Globally Important Agricultural Heritage Systems (GIAHS) which promotes an agricultural landscape becomes a sustainable agricultural heritage system. However, Indonesia as an agricultural country, did not yet has any site that have been registered and participated as a GIAHS site. In fact, there is area with traditional agricultural landscape that is highly potential to be registered, namely Sudaji Village, located in Buleleng Regency, Bali. Therefore, this study aims to identify and analyze the potential and constraints of Sudaji Village regarding its agricultural landscape to be designated as GIAHS Sites in Indonesia. The methods used in this research are benchmarking method and field survey. The results showed that Sudaji Village met the five criterias to be designated as one of GIAHS Sites, as follow: (1) the contribution of the agricultural system to food security and livelihoods, (2) the use of biodiversity as a source of food and agriculture, (3) knowledge and experience of traditional community systems that are still being maintained, (4) the existence of two village government systems that affect the value system and culture of the community, and (5) the landscape condition that is influenced by people's knowledge in managing agricultural landscapes. Hopefully, Sudaji Village will become a part of the GIAHS Sites with its potentials.
